siouxesighed | Hi there..UK only plz ...How to work out how much tax you pay? |
Ive always been self emplyoyed so I have always paid my own tax, now I have a normal everyday job I want to work out how much tax I have to pay. Say I earn £500 a wk, how would i work it out on a calculator how much tax i would pay, i dont even know what the tax rate is, behind the times im afraid..
Many thx.. |

In a tax year, on your total earnings, you get the first 5000 tax free, the next 2000 at 10%, the next 30000 at 22% and anything else at 40%. You also need to pay national insurance under two contributions. Under class 4 NI you pay £2.10 a week and under class 2 you pay earnings between 5000 and 32000 at 8% and anything above that at 1%. The earning amounts are approximate as they change each tax year.
If you earn 500 a week that will be 26000 per year so in Tax you will pay £4380 and NI will be class 4 £109 and class 2 1680. Therefore total tax on 26000 will be 6169. Therefore percentage will be 23.7% and on 500 a week it will work out as approx. £118.63 |
